Broken Glass
Glass doors are an attractive and functional addition to any home or business. They allow natural light to shine through and make spaces appear larger, they can also add an elegant look to any space, and they're an excellent way to display sales items or entice people who pass by. But they're not immune to the whims of New York weather and can be easily damaged or scratched by rough handling. A professional door repairman will assist you in filling in cracks and scratches to stop them from getting worse, as well as re-glazing the glass to provide protection against further damage.
Door repair companies usually specialize in repairing doors with glass, including patio and sliding doors, French doors, shower doors, and entranceways. They can repair dents, cracks, and chips in the glass. They can also replace damaged hardware and ensure that the door functions and closes correctly. They also offer fireproof door maintenance that involves repairing fireproof seals and closing mechanisms, ensuring adequate clearance and alignment, and making sure that the doors are still functioning as fireproof barriers.
The cost of repair will depend on the type of door and the amount to which it requires fixing. Hollow-core interior door, for instance, are less heavy and more affordable to repair than solid wood or metal exterior doors. Wrought iron doors are sturdy and durable, but they are also more expensive to fix than other types of door. Additionally, if the technician is required to remove broken pieces of your door or decides to replace it completely there could be additional fees for materials and disposal.

Broken Hinges
Your door is a key point to your home, and it's crucial that it operates properly. A damaged door can be a security risk and ruin your home's aesthetic. Taskers can swiftly and inexpensively repair your doors and get them back in working in good working order.
The cost of fixing doors is contingent on their nature and the severity. It can be as little as $50 to repair small holes, dents and dings. It could cost up to $700 for more extensive repairs, Composite Door Repairs Near Me such as replacing the passage set, the lock with a key or refinishing the frame.
It's possible that the top hinge screws are loose if the upper hinge door hinges swell or aren't closing properly. You can easily solve this issue by putting some shims to the hinges. The cost of the wood can vary from $5 to $10, depending on the dimensions and shape of your door. This will help the screw be positioned in the hinge opening in a proper way and also give it more strength.
Sagging is another common problem. It occurs when the part closest to the hinge opens and creates gaps between the frame and the door. This can be resolved by tightening the hinge screws, however, it's usually more efficient for a professional to plan or sand the door to take out the sagging and restore the original shape.
Both interior and external doors can wear out particularly if they are used by a crowded household. They are also susceptible to damage by weather (snow rain, snow) or other conditions like an increase in humidity. DIYers can fix sagging, expanding or sticking doors, but major warping, buckleling or rusting may require the replacement of the entire door.

Rust
The most common problem affecting your door hinges is misaligned. This can be caused by normal wear and tear or rusty hinges that need to be repaired or replaced. If your doors are not aligned you will encounter a lot of friction between the frame and the door, and this could cause squeaking or creaking. You can fix this issue by tightening the hinge screws or replacing them with longer screws.
Scratches on your door or frame are another frequent issue. It is important to address these issues as soon as they notice them, because if they are not addressed, they can lead to rust which may require a complete replacement. Metal polishing can help with small scratches, but it's best to call for a professional repair of your entry door.
